๐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,677 in Grosuplje versus $1,608 in Postojna.
๐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,561 in Grosuplje versus $2,426 in Postojna.
๐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,444 in Grosuplje versus $3,244 in Postojna.
๐Living in Grosuplje is roughly 4% more expensive than Postojna, driven mainly by Eating Out.
๐Both cities are pricier than the global median: Grosuplje25% above, Postojna20% above.

๐ A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$674 in Grosuplje and $674 in Postojna.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
๐ฐGrosuplje pays 27%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
๐Dining out: $69 in Grosuplje vs $53 in Postojna for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$291 vs $278 per month, with Postojna cheaper across the board.
